The Crossing Adds Christmas Concert to Season

By Francisco Salazar

The Crossing, conducted by Donald Nally, is adding another New York City performance to its schedule for the upcoming season.

The chorus will give a New York performance of its December show, “Our Lives, Our Fortunes, Our Sacred Honor,” as part of the series “The Crossing @ Christmas 2025.”

The concert will take place on Dec. 20, at 5:00 p.m. at St. Peter’s Church in New York and will feature the world premieres of Sarah Rimkus’ “Nativity” and Ukrainian composer Natalia Tsupryk’s “Kyiv.” Both works feature cellist Thomas Mesa.

The New York performance will take place between two Philadelphia concerts on Dec. 19 at St. Mark’s Church and Dec. 21 at The Presbyterian Church of Chestnut Hill.
